Understanding Spiritual Growth

At its core, spiritual growth involves the expansion of consciousness and awareness. It signifies a shift from a purely materialistic view of life to one that encompasses deeper meanings and connections. This journey often starts with a moment of awakening, spurred by personal crises, existential questions, or a simple yearning for something more profound than the everyday experience.

The Role of Change

Change is not just inevitable; it is essential for spiritual growth. In many traditions, the idea of transformation is woven into the very fabric of existence. Whether through the cycles of nature, life and death, or even personal experiences—everything is in flux. Embracing change allows us to let go of rigid beliefs and structures that no longer serve our higher purpose.

Stages of Transformation

Transformative journeys can be broken down into several stages, each characterized by distinct challenges and lessons. Understanding these stages can provide insight into one’s own journey toward spiritual enlightenment.

1. Awakening

The first stage in any transformative journey begins with awakening—a realization that there is more to life than meets the eye. This might happen suddenly or unfold gradually over time. During this phase, individuals often feel a sense of discontentment or restlessness, prompting them to seek deeper answers.

2. Disorientation

After the initial excitement of awakening comes disorientation—a confusing period where old beliefs are challenged, leading to feelings of uncertainty and fear. This stage is crucial; it’s where individuals confront their shadows—the parts of themselves they may have ignored or suppressed.

3. Integration

Once you’ve navigated through disorientation, the next step is integration. Here, you begin to assimilate new beliefs and understandings into your daily life. This might involve making significant changes in relationships, career paths, or lifestyle choices that align more closely with your newfound values.

Embracing Change in Daily Life

As we journey through these transformative stages, embracing change becomes a daily practice rather than a singular event. Here are some practical strategies for integrating this mindset into everyday life:

Cultivating Mindfulness

Mindfulness allows you to become present in each moment, making it easier to recognize when change is necessary. Regular practices such as meditation can help ground you during turbulent times.

Setting Intentions

Establish clear intentions for what you wish to achieve on your spiritual journey. Writing these down can serve as a compass during challenging moments when doubt creeps in.

Building Resilience

Resilience is key when facing change. Developing coping mechanisms—such as physical activity or creative outlets—can help you manage stress and navigate emotional upheaval with grace.

Seeking Community

Finding a supportive community can make navigating change easier and more fulfilling. Whether through spiritual groups or online forums, connecting with others who share similar goals can provide invaluable support.

The Importance of Self-Compassion

Amidst all this change, it’s vital to practice self-compassion. Transformation can be messy; there will be setbacks along the way. Recognizing that it’s okay to stumble allows for greater acceptance and understanding during difficult times.

Practicing Forgiveness

Forgiveness—both toward oneself and others—is essential in letting go of past grievances that may hinder spiritual progress. Holding onto grudges creates energetic blockages that impede growth.

Finding Guidance

Many people find solace in seeking guidance from mentors, spiritual leaders, or sacred texts during their journeys. These resources can offer valuable wisdom and perspective during times of confusion or doubt.

Engaging with Nature

Nature has an innate ability to inspire and heal us on our journeys. Spending time outdoors can provide clarity and remind us of our connection to something larger than ourselves.
